Russian President Vladimir Putin has condemned the terrorist bombing that targeted a market in Sadr City, Iraq, which killed and wounded dozens.
A Kremlin statement reported by RIA Novosti news agency stated that President Putin offered his condolences to his Iraqi counterpart, Barham Salih, for the victims of the terrorist bombing. .
"This criminal act is shocking in its cruelty, and we strongly condemn this brutality and hope that its organizers and perpetrators will receive the punishment they deserve," Putin added.
Putin reiterated his country's readiness to cooperate with Iraq in the fight against terrorism, sending warm condolences and support to the families and friends of the victims and wishing the wounded a speedy recovery.
Yesterday, a terrorist detonated an explosive device targeting a popular market in Sadr City, east of the Iraqi capital, Baghdad, killing 27 people, including a child, and wounding 45 others.
